Travel to Malaga, Spain * Malaga Travel Guide | S01E15

November 28, 2021 14:00 - 5 minutes - 4.88 MB

Travel to Malaga, Spain! A walking tour with a guide in the Spanish city ► The Phoenicians first colonized the city of Malaga in 1000 B.C. and named it Malaka. The name of the city probably came from the Phoenician word 'Malac' which means 'to salt'.  The Phoenicians settled along the river, which was the fish-salting center.   The beautiful city of Malaga offers around 330 sunny days in the year!   *Alcazaba* Malaga was under Moorish rule for over 7 centuries. WHY WE CHANGE TIME - Daylight Saving Time Explained in 4 min (DST) * S01E13

October 31, 2021 14:09 - 4 minutes - 4.5 MB

Why do we change to DST or Daylight Saving Time? History is happy to explain this to us. It goes back to Benjamin Franklin who only mentioned it in an essay in the 18th century. George Hudson, who was born in New Zealand, introduced it for the first time almost 100 years later. But the first countries to implement it were the German Empire and Austro-Hungary in 1916 in order to save money from electricity and put them into war production. DST was used in WWI & WWII by other countries as well...
